I'm sure exercise is really hard to fit into your schedule, so I'd just try to stick to your calorie limit for now. The burn meter on calorie count is the number of calories you burn throughout the day [not including workouts or extra activities] based on what you chose for your activity. If you eat 500 calories less than that a day, you'll lose 1lb a week. [3,500 Calories=1lb] If you add exercise, you'll lose even more. Never go below 1,200 calories though.
